Why Securing Official World Cup 2026 Tickets Matters

In the modern era of sports entertainment, ticket fraud has become highly sophisticated. FIFA has implemented strict security measures to ensure that only authorized ticket holders can enter the venues. For the World Cup 2026, all general admission tickets are purely digital and delivered through a proprietary mobile application. This makes physical paper tickets or simple PDF printouts entirely obsolete for stadium entry.

If you purchase a ticket from an unauthorized source, you run a high risk of being turned away at the gates. FIFA’s ticketing terms of service explicitly state that tickets transferred outside of official channels are void. Furthermore, because these digital tickets utilize dynamic barcodes that update frequently, static screenshots of barcodes will not work at the turnstiles. Therefore, obtaining your tickets through authorized pathways is the only way to ensure your admission is guaranteed.

On the other hand, the financial implications of buying counterfeit tickets are devastating. Many fans save for years to travel to the tournament, only to find their tickets are invalid at the gate. Not only do they miss the match, but they also lose thousands of dollars spent on flights, hotels, and local travel. Staying within the official ecosystem is the only way to protect both your wallet and your tournament experience.

The Risks of Unofficial Platforms

Many secondary ticket marketplaces claim to offer buyer protection and guaranteed entry. However, the reality on the ground can be much more complicated. Unofficial platforms often list tickets that the seller does not yet actually possess, a practice known as speculative selling. Sellers on these platforms hope to purchase a ticket at a lower price later and transfer it to you, which frequently fails during high-demand matches.

In addition to the high failure rate, these unofficial platforms are notorious for exorbitant price markups. Scalpers routinely list tickets for five to ten times their face value, exploiting the passion of fans. More importantly, if a transaction falls through on an unofficial site, their guarantee typically only covers a financial refund. Consequently, this leaves you stranded outside the stadium doors on match day without a way to watch the game.

Furthermore, because FIFA actively monitors secondary markets, they have the authority to cancel any tickets discovered on unauthorized resale websites. This means even if you buy a ticket from a well-known resale platform, FIFA’s ticketing systems may flag and invalidate that specific ticket before you arrive at the venue. The risk remains unacceptably high for anyone hoping to guarantee their entry.

Safe Methods to Purchase Last-Minute World Cup 2026 Tickets

Fortunately, there are still secure pathways available for fans looking to buy tickets in the final days leading up to a match. By sticking to these official channels, you can protect your hard-earned money and secure genuine access to the matches.

1. The Official FIFA World Cup 2026 Resale Platform

The safest and most reliable method to buy last-minute tickets is through the official FIFA Tickets Portal. This platform allows fans who bought tickets during earlier sales phases but can no longer attend to resell them at face value. Because FIFA directly facilitates these transactions, the original ticket is canceled and a brand-new, unique digital ticket is issued to the new buyer.

Furthermore, buying through the official portal ensures you pay the original face value plus a nominal administration fee. This completely eliminates the threat of price gouging. Since fans constantly list tickets as their personal plans change, checking the portal frequently—especially in the 24 to 48 hours before kick-off—is highly recommended.

In addition, using the official portal means your ticket resides directly in your official FIFA account. This guarantees that the ticket is authentic and will work seamlessly at the stadium turnstiles. It represents the gold standard for secure ticketing, providing absolute peace of mind.

2. Official Hospitality Packages (On Location)

If the regular ticketing portal is sold out, official hospitality packages offer an alternative, high-end route. On Location is the exclusive official hospitality provider for the tournament. These packages combine match tickets with premium stadium services, such as upscale dining, lounge access, and guest appearances by football legends.

While hospitality packages are significantly more expensive than standard tickets, they offer a secure guarantee of authenticity. For fans with the budget, these packages often remain available closer to match day because they are not subject to the same rapid sell-out rates as standard category tickets. You can explore these packages directly via the official FIFA Hospitality Platform.

Moreover, these packages offer a comprehensive match-day experience. If you are traveling internationally and want to ensure your trip is seamless, purchasing a hospitality package removes the stress of ticketing queues and provides a premium, safe environment to enjoy the game.

3. Participating Member Association (PMA) Allocations

Each participating nation’s national football federation receives a dedicated allocation of tickets for their team’s matches. These are managed through Participating Member Associations (PMAs). If a country has an active fan club or supporters’ group, they often receive special priority codes or dedicated windows to purchase tickets.

Consequently, it is worth checking with the official supporters’ group of the teams playing in your city. Sometimes, unsold allocations from opposing teams are returned to the general pool or redistributed to local supporters close to match day. This represents an excellent, often overlooked pathway for genuine supporters.

Additionally, some PMAs operate their own official travel and ticket networks. Engaging with these national fan clubs early in the tournament can give you access to returned tickets that never make it to the public resale portal, providing an invaluable opportunity for last-minute buyers.

Common Scams and Risks with World Cup 2026 Ticket Resellers

Understanding the common tactics utilized by fraudsters can help you identify a potential scam before you lose your money. As the tournament approaches kick-off, the frequency of these malicious schemes increases significantly.

The Social Media Trap

Scammers frequently use Facebook Groups, Reddit threads, Telegram channels, and X (formerly Twitter) to advertise last-minute tickets. They often post highly convincing stories about why they cannot attend, such as a family emergency or a sudden work conflict. They will offer the tickets at a discount to create a sense of urgency.

However, once you express interest, they will insist on using non-refundable payment methods like Zelle, Cash App, wire transfers, or cryptocurrency. Once you send the money, the seller will instantly block your account and disappear, leaving you with absolutely no way to recover your funds. Always remember that legitimate fans rarely sell high-value tickets below face value on social media.

On the other hand, some scammers may use hijacked social media accounts of real people to make their listings look authentic. Even if the profile looks like a family-oriented person with years of posting history, the account may have been compromised. Do not let a friendly profile picture lower your defenses.

Fake PDF and Screenshot Tickets

Another common scam involves providing buyers with a fake PDF file or a screenshot of a mobile ticket. The scammer might tell you that they can email you the ticket or send it via WhatsApp. They may even customize the PDF to feature realistic logos, seat numbers, and barcodes.

Unfortunately, as mentioned previously, the tournament relies exclusively on dynamic ticketing. This means that a printed page or a static screenshot is entirely useless. The security turnstiles at the stadium will not read static barcodes, and you will be denied entry at the gate. Never accept any ticket that is not transferred directly within the official FIFA mobile app.

Key Steps to Take if You Buy Resale Tickets

If you choose to navigate the secondary market despite the risks, there are crucial precautions you must take to minimize your chances of being scammed. Following these steps can help protect your financial assets.

  • Never Pay with Cash or Wire Transfers: Always use a payment method that offers strong buyer protection, such as a major credit card or PayPal Goods and Services. Avoid payment options that function like cash, as they offer no dispute process.
  • Demand Official App Transfer: Inform the seller that you will only accept tickets transferred directly through the official mobile ticketing application. Do not accept email attachments, PDFs, or external links.
  • Verify the Seller’s Identity: If purchasing through an individual, ask to video call them to verify their identity and see the tickets actively sitting inside their official ticketing app. If they refuse or make excuses, walk away immediately.
  • Avoid Underpriced Deals: If a deal seems too good to be true, it almost certainly is. Tickets for high-demand matches will rarely be sold below face value by third-party individuals.

Furthermore, keep detailed records of all your communication with the seller. Save screenshots of the listing, the conversation, and the payment confirmation. If the transaction turns out to be fraudulent, this documentation will be vital when filing a dispute with your bank or credit card provider to recover your funds.

Important Travel and Stadium Entry Requirements

Securing a safe ticket is only the first part of your journey. To ensure a seamless experience on match day, you must also understand the logistical requirements of attending World Cup 2026 games.

For international travelers, obtaining the appropriate travel authorization or visa is paramount. To assist with this process, eligible ticket holders can utilize the FIFA PASS system to help schedule priority visa appointments. Furthermore, you should plan your local transit well in advance. Stadium parking is highly limited, and public transportation networks in host cities will be incredibly busy.

Additionally, remember that security protocols at all venues are highly stringent. Ensure you review the prohibited items list for each specific stadium. Arrive at least two to three hours before kick-off to allow enough time for security screenings and digital ticket verification at the turnstiles.

Consequently, having a fully charged smartphone on match day is essential. Because your ticket is entirely digital, you cannot enter the stadium if your phone battery dies. Carrying a portable power bank is highly recommended to ensure you can access your ticket when you reach the gates.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Here are the answers to some of the most common questions fans have regarding purchasing last-minute tickets for the tournament.

Q1: Can I buy World Cup 2026 tickets directly at the stadium on match day?
No, there are no physical ticket offices or box offices at the stadiums selling tickets on match day. All ticketing is entirely digital and must be purchased online through the official FIFA platform. Do not travel to the stadium expecting to buy a paper ticket from a booth or a scalper outside the gates.

Q2: Is it legal or safe to buy tickets from secondary marketplaces like StubHub or Viagogo?
While these platforms are popular, they operate in a legal gray area because FIFA’s terms of service prohibit the unauthorized resale or transfer of tickets. While some buyers successfully receive transferred tickets through these sites, there is no guarantee. If a seller fails to transfer the ticket to your official app, you will only receive a refund, not a ticket to the match.

Q3: How do I know if a last-minute ticket is genuine?
A ticket is only 100% genuine if it is successfully transferred directly into your official mobile ticketing account. If a seller offers you a screenshot of a ticket, a printed copy, or a PDF file, it is highly likely to be a scam. The official ticketing app uses a dynamic, moving barcode that cannot be faked or screenshotted.

Q4: What should I do if the official resale portal shows no tickets available?
The official resale portal updates in real time as fans list their tickets for sale. If no tickets are currently available, do not give up. Check the platform frequently, especially in the 24 to 48 hours before the game, as many fans realize they cannot attend at the last minute and list their tickets then.

Q5: Can I transfer a ticket to a friend if I bought it but cannot attend?
Yes, you can transfer tickets to your guests or friends directly through the official mobile application. However, FIFA restricts this to personal transfers. Selling tickets for profit or listing them on unauthorized third-party websites violates the terms of service and can lead to the cancellation of the tickets.

Q6: Are there any safe payment methods for private ticket sales?
If you must buy from an individual, only use payment platforms that offer robust buyer protection, such as PayPal Goods and Services. This service allows you to file a dispute and request a refund if the seller fails to deliver the promised item. Never use wire transfers, bank deposits, Zelle, Cash App, or cryptocurrency, as these transactions are permanent and non-refundable.
